You know what's interesting about the Riyadh Diplomatic Quarter - Marriott Executive Apartments? It's tucked away in one of Riyadh's most prestigious neighborhoods, and honestly, it feels more like staying in an upscale residential building than a typical hotel. The first time I walked into the lobby, I was struck by how quiet everything was – there's this almost library-like calm that's pretty rare in the city center. The apartments themselves are genuinely spacious (I mean, we're talking full kitchens and separate living areas), which makes sense since this place clearly caters to diplomats and long-term business travelers who need actual living space, not just a bed for the night.
What really sets this place apart is the attention to those little details that matter when you're staying somewhere for more than a few days. The kitchen actually has proper cookware – not those flimsy hotel pans that make you want to order room service instead. The washing machine in each unit is a game-changer if you're doing extended business trips. And the Wi-Fi? Rock solid, which is crucial when you're trying to video conference with colleagues back home. The building feels secure without being fortress-like, probably because of all the diplomatic activity in the area. You'll notice the discreet but professional security presence, and parking is refreshingly straightforward – no circling blocks looking for a spot like you'd face in other parts of the city.
The location is actually pretty smart if you understand Riyadh's layout. The Diplomatic Quarter has this planned, almost suburban feel that's completely different from the bustling commercial districts. You're close enough to major business areas without dealing with the constant traffic chaos, and there are some surprisingly good restaurants within walking distance that cater to the international crowd. The 8.4 rating makes total sense to me – it's not trying to be flashy or Instagram-perfect, but it absolutely nails the fundamentals of what business travelers actually need. I've stayed in supposedly fancier places that couldn't match the practical comfort level here. The staff genuinely seems to understand that their guests are often dealing with jet lag, long work days, and the general stress of extended travel, so there's this understated professionalism that feels refreshingly authentic.
